Blair’s latest book “The Wickedest Books in the World: Confessions of an Aleister Crowley Bibliophile’” is having a launch party at the Cha Cha Lounge in LA on the 23rd of March.  Danny, who wrote the foreword for the book will be at the party, and possibly other Tool members if I’m reading it right.

You will be able to purchase the book on the night, and get it autographed, presumably by a purple marker of some description.  Check Toolband/Toolarmy for more details!
